
BODY {
	MARGIN-TOP: 0px; FONT-SIZE: 10pt; background-color:#003366; MARGIN-LEFT: 5px; FONT-FAMILY: Arial, Helvetica
}
P {
	font-family:arial,sans-serif; font-size: 13px;
}

A.TaskMenu:hover {
	COLOR: #ff0000; TEXT-DECORATION: none
}
TD.Cap {
	FONT: bold 9pt Arial, Helvetica; COLOR: navy
}
TD.CapC {
	FONT: bold 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: center
}

TD.Desc {
	FONT: 9pt Arial, Helvetica; COLOR: black
}
TD.DescC {
	FONT: 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: center
}

INPUT.editButton {
	FONT: bold 8pt Arial, Helvetica
}
TD.IOCap {
	FONT: 10pt Arial, Helvetica; COLOR: black
}
TD.IOWarning {
	FONT: 9pt Arial, Helvetica; COLOR: red
}
TD.IODesc {
	FONT: 10pt Arial, Helvetica; COLOR: black
}

TD.IOlist {
	FONT: bold 9pt Arial, Helvetica; COLOR: black
}

TD.ErrorMessage {
	FONT: 9pt Arial, Helvetica; COLOR: red
}
TR.ErrorRow {
	BACKGROUND: #FFFFCC
}

TABLE.staticBox TD.title {
	FONT: bold 11pt Arial, Helvetica, sans-serif; COLOR: navy;  TEXT-ALIGN: left; 	
}
TABLE.staticBox TD.titleC {
	FONT: bold 11pt Arial, Helvetica; COLOR: navy;  TEXT-ALIGN: center	
}
TABLE.staticBox TD.cap {
	FONT: 10p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: center
}
TABLE.staticBox TD.list {
	FONT: 9pt Arial, Helvetica; COLOR: black
}
TABLE.staticBox TD.listC {
	FONT: 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: center
}
TABLE.staticBox TD.listR {
	FONT: 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: right
}
TABLE.staticBox TD.listYes {
	FONT: 9pt Arial, Helvetica; COLOR: green; TEXT-ALIGN: center
}
TABLE.staticBox TD.listNo {
	FONT: 9pt Arial, Helvetica; COLOR: red; TEXT-ALIGN: center
}
TABLE.staticBox TD.total {
	FONT: bold 9pt Arial, Helvetica; COLOR: black
}
TABLE.staticBox TD.totalC {
	FONT: bold 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: center
}
TABLE.staticBox TD.totalR {
	FONT: bold 9pt Arial, Helvetica; COLOR: black; TEXT-ALIGN: right
}
TABLE.staticBox TR.evenRow {
	BACKGROUND: #f4f4f4
}
TABLE.staticBox TR.oddRow {
	BACKGROUND: white
}
TABLE.staticBox TR.totalRow {
	BACKGROUND: #eaeaea
}
TABLE.staticBox TR.headerRow {
	BACKGROUND: #e8eee0
}

H1.title {
	FONT: bold 11pt Arial, Helvetica, sans-serif; COLOR: navy;  TEXT-ALIGN: left; margin-top: 0; margin-bottom: 0.7em;
}
H2.subTitle {
	FONT: bold 9pt Arial, Helvetica; COLOR: black;  margin-top: 0; margin-bottom: 0.4em;
}
H1.homePageTitle {
	font-size: 1.35em; margin: .75em 0; margin-top: 0; text-align:center; padding:0;
}

.c2 {
  color: #6060b0;
  font-family: Verdana,Arial,Sans-serif;
  font-size: 16px;
}

a.HeaderLink, a.HeaderLink:link, a.HeaderLink:visited {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#000000; text-decoration:none; font-weight:bold;}

a.QuizLink, a.QuizLink:link, a.QuizLink:visited {color:#0000FF;}

a.AnswerLink, a.AnswerLink:link, a.AnswerLink:visited {color:black; text-decoration:none;}

a.AnswerLink:hover {color:red; text-decoration:none; }

TD.menuMain_on {
	BORDER-TOP: black 1px solid; BACKGROUND: #339900; FONT: 10pt Arial, Helvetica;  TEXT-ALIGN: center
}
TD.menuMain_off {
	border-top: navy 1px solid; BACKGROUND: #99ccff; FONT: 10pt Arial, Helvetica; COLOR: black; BORDER-BOTTOM: black 1px solid; TEXT-ALIGN: center
}
A.menuMainURL_on {
	FONT: 9pt Arial, Helvetica; COLOR: #FFFFFF; TEXT-DECORATION: none
}
A.menuMainURL_off {
	FONT: 9pt Arial, Helvetica; COLOR: #000000; TEXT-DECORATION: none
}
